Governor Uba Sani of Kaduna has received the rescued Kuriga schoolchildren at the Sir Kashim Ibrahim Government House in Kaduna State.

The students were accompanied by the General Officer Commanding (GOC) of One Mechanised Division of the Nigerian Army Major Gen Mayirenso Saraso and other Army officers.

They were received by the Chief of Staff to the Kaduna State Governor Sani Kila and the Commissioner of Internal Security and Home Affairs Samuel Aruwan.

While presenting the children to Governor Sani, the GOC said six out of the 137 rescued students are hospitalised at a military hospital.

An excited Governor Sani also exchanged pleasantries with the rescued schoolchildren.

He cautioned against politicizing insecurity in Kaduna, assuring residents that the security of lives and properties remains a priority for his administration.
